Welcome to HairSay!

This blog is about my attempt to teach myself the process of creating wigs and hairpieces.  There doesn't seem to be a great deal of information out there on this subject, despite the fact that there seem to be a lot of people interested in learning wig making.  I'm hoping that this will be a place to share ideas and information with others who are interested in the process.

I have just finished the ventilation of my first hairpiece, and I'm pretty happy with it.  Unfortunately, I didn't take many photos before the piece was finished, but I decided to start documenting my progress.  I encountered so many problems along the way, which I will detail as the blog progresses, but for now I would just like to post a few photos of the piece.

The unit was made using a single piece of lace (which was sold as 'Swiss' lace, although it is much stiffer and heavier than other Swiss lace I have found subsequently.  That will be the topic of a later blog...)  The hair is a combination of Brazilian Remy human hair (ash brown) and Futura synthetic hair (white).  The entire piece was ventilated using single hairs, and single knots.  The photos show the piece before the hair has been cut, and also before the knots have been bleached.
